With summer flying by and Labor Day fast-approaching, the My ArundelBiz podcast is proud to highlight Project Opportunity, a free entrepreneurship training program designed solely for Veterans (Active Duty, Guard/Reserve Personnel, and Veterans) who want to start or expand their small business, and its Spouse Entrepreneurship Training Course.

We sat down with Joe Giordano, the founder of Project Opportunity and a great partner of the Maryland Small Business Development Center, to discuss:

– What led him to create Project Opportunity, which launched in September 2010, and the Spouse Entrepreneurship Training Course, an offshoot designed specifically for Veterans’ spouses or dependents.

– How the programs’ curriculums and expert-led training, much like those of AAEDC’s Inclusive Ventures Program, have allowed 383 Project Opportunity graduates and 25 Spouse Entrepreneurship Course graduates to grow their businesses and create jobs throughout Maryland.

– Some of the diverse businesses created by program graduates, from KISS MY GLASS Window Cleaners and Queen of Spades Style and Jammin’ Together (Project Opportunity) to Reveille Grounds and Stephanie McLaughlin Photography (Spouse Entrepreneurship Training Course).

– PLUS his top 5 reasons that Veterans’ spouses or dependents should consider applying to participate in the Military Spouse Fall 2022 Class, taking place on Wednesday evenings from September 14th, 2022 to November 9th, 2022 at the Anne Arundel Workforce Development Career Center in Linthicum, Maryland.
